Ireland’s Employment Boom
As we approach midyear, Ireland’s labour market continues to demonstrate exceptional strength and resilience, underpinned by near-full employment and sustained economic growth. With the unemployment rate at just 4% in March 2025 (significantly lower than the EU average of 6.1%), Irish businesses face a highly competitive hiring landscape.
Key trends we’re seeing:
Record Employment Levels: Over 2.77 million people are now in employment, representing a year-on-year increase of 70,000.
Net Inward Migration of 79,300 in 2024, particularly from Ukraine and India, presents new opportunities to access skilled international talent.
Rising Female Participation: With over 1.3 million women now employed, female workforce engagement is at an all-time high, helping to narrow the gender gap.
Strong Wage Growth: Average weekly earnings rose by 5.6% in Q4 2024, underscoring the need for employers to remain competitive on pay and benefits.
Ireland Among Europe’s Top Earners: We now boast the 2nd highest minimum wage and 3rd highest average salary in the EU.
However, even amid this buoyancy, skills shortages remain acute in key sectors such as construction, nursing, accounting, software development, and engineering.
